i have a new blanket.

when i turn it on i get E i unplug it and plug it in later and i still get E

The "E" is an Error message. Unplug the controller and then plug it in again. Hopefully it will reset the controller. If it still comes back with the "E", then the controller is bad and needs replaced. Call customer service number to get a return authorization.

What is Biddeford Blankets return policy?

0 symbols (min 100)
Answer:
by #1648812

The Biddeford Blankets Warranty and Return page states that all Biddeford Blankets’ products are warranted for 5 years. The warranty covers the following units: the controller, the blanket itself, cords, mattress pads, and throws. The warranty does not cover abuse, accidents, and damage resulting from failure to follow instructions, or modifications to the unit not carried by the manufacturer. The warranty is only valid if the online Warranty Registration Form or the Warranty Registration Card included with the product has been filled out and submitted to the company. You may complete the online warranty registration form here https://www.biddefordblankets.com/apps/product-registration. According to the Biddeford Blankets return policy, all returns must first have a Return Authorization Number issued by the company. A consumer who is going to send their product to Biddeford Blankets for Warranty Service should call to request a Return Authorization Number from the company. This number should be clearly identified on the shipping box.
